- sushilkumarMay 31, 2024 · 2 years agoSpread fees play a crucial role in cryptocurrency trading. When you buy or sell a cryptocurrency, there is a difference between the buying price and the selling price, known as the spread. This spread represents the fee charged by the exchange for facilitating the trade. The impact of spread fees on trading can be significant, especially for high-frequency traders and those executing large orders. Higher spread fees can eat into profits and make it more challenging to execute profitable trades. Traders need to consider spread fees when formulating their trading strategies and ensure that the potential profits outweigh the costs of trading.
